4Texans is a search engine built specifically for Texans. Whether you need a contractor in Dallas, a county clerk office in Hays County, or the best brisket in Austin, 4Texans combines multiple search indexes, algorithms, and AI tools to deliver results tuned to Texas queries. We index local government pages, community sites, regional news outlets, and local businesses to make it easier to find relevant, practical information across the state.
